Conrad Cohen is an actor, acting teacher, director, and producer currently working towards an MA in Actor Training and Coaching at the Royal Central School of Speech and Drama. He previously trained as an actor at the American Academy of Dramatic Arts in New York and as a director at the Royal Conservatoire of Scotland in his native Glasgow. He is a qualified teacher currently in the post of Head of Drama at St Margaret’s School in London, England.
Conrad is also curating the theatre strand of Tsitsit, a new Jewish fringe festival running for the first time in October 2021 across the UK. As part of this festival, he is directing and producing a verbatim theatre piece featuring the testimonies of residents of Jewish Care.
In his practice as an actor trainer he is currently exploring how to adapt and combine European and American acting methods for the 21st century actor, and his research is looking to interrogate the Jewish influence on the fields of actor training and performance education.
